服务器是程序吗,服务器,代码的王国,程序的化身——揭秘服务器与代码的密不可分关系
- 综合资讯
- 2024-12-08 06:44:30
- 1

服务器是程序的实体化身,承载着代码的运行与生命。它是代码的王国,两者密不可分,共同构建起互联网的基石。...
服务器是程序的实体化身,承载着代码的运行与生命。它是代码的王国,两者密不可分,共同构建起互联网的基石。
在信息化时代,服务器作为计算机网络的基石,扮演着至关重要的角色,它为用户提供了强大的数据处理能力,支撑着互联网世界的繁荣发展,在深入了解服务器的工作原理之前,我们不禁要问:服务器的本质,难道仅仅是代码吗?本文将带领大家揭开服务器与代码之间密不可分的神秘面纱。
服务器概述
1、定义
服务器,顾名思义,是一种专门为其他计算机提供服务的计算机系统,它通过接收、处理和发送数据,实现资源共享、信息传递等功能,服务器通常具有较高的性能、稳定性、安全性等特点。
2、类型
根据应用场景和功能,服务器可分为以下几种类型:
(1)文件服务器:主要负责存储、管理和共享文件资源。
(2)数据库服务器:用于存储、管理和查询大量数据。
(3)应用服务器:负责处理特定应用程序的业务逻辑。
(4)游戏服务器:为网络游戏提供数据传输、角色管理等功能。
(5)邮件服务器:处理电子邮件的发送、接收和存储。
服务器与代码的关系
1、服务器是代码的载体
服务器并非仅仅是硬件设备,更是代码的载体,代码是服务器实现功能的灵魂,没有代码,服务器将失去生命力,在服务器上运行的代码,包括操作系统、应用程序、中间件等,共同构成了一个完整的服务器系统。
2、代码是服务器的灵魂
代码决定了服务器的工作方式、性能、安全性等关键因素,优秀的代码能够提高服务器的运行效率,降低故障率,提升用户体验,以下是代码对服务器的影响:
(1)性能:代码的编写质量直接影响服务器的响应速度和处理能力,优秀的代码能够让服务器高效地处理大量数据,提高用户体验。
(2)稳定性:良好的代码结构、严谨的算法设计能够降低服务器故障率,提高系统稳定性。
(3)安全性:代码的安全漏洞可能导致服务器遭受攻击,造成数据泄露,编写安全可靠的代码至关重要。
(4)可维护性:代码的可读性、可扩展性、可维护性直接影响服务器的后期维护和升级。
3、服务器与代码的互动
服务器与代码之间并非单向依赖,而是相互影响、相互促进的,以下列举几个例子:
(1)服务器硬件升级:随着硬件技术的不断发展,服务器硬件性能不断提升,这要求服务器上的代码进行相应的优化,以充分利用硬件优势。
(2)软件更新:为了修复漏洞、提高性能、增强功能,服务器上的代码需要不断更新,这要求服务器具备较强的兼容性和可扩展性。
(3)网络安全:面对日益严峻的网络攻击,服务器上的代码需要具备更高的安全性,这要求开发人员关注代码的安全性,并采取相应措施。
服务器与代码之间的关系密不可分,代码是服务器的灵魂,服务器是代码的载体,只有优秀的代码才能构建出高性能、稳定、安全的服务器系统,在信息化时代,我们应重视代码质量,不断提升服务器性能,为用户提供优质的服务。
本文链接:https://www.zhitaoyun.cn/1406012.html
发表评论